Travel Tips
⛰ Enjoy the Scenic Views
The train journey from Gwalior to Bareilly offers beautiful landscape views, especially as you pass by the Chambal River and explore rural settlements. Grab a window seat for the best experience!
📍 Local Delicacies
Pack some local snacks or try the station vendors' offerings—Gwalior is known for its 'Bhutte ka Kees' and Bareilly for its 'Biryani'. Enjoying local cuisine while traveling adds to the experience.
🚍 Be Aware of Train Schedules
Trains may not always stick to their timetable. Keep track of your train’s status using apps or inquire at the station for real-time updates to avoid frustrations.
🎭 Cultural Insights
Engage with fellow passengers by learning a few phrases in Hindi or local dialects. This can enrich your travel experience as it opens up opportunities to connect with the locals.
🏛 Plan for Seasonal Events
Check for local festivals or events in both Gwalior and Bareilly. Events can lead to crowded trains or limited accommodations, so booking in advance is recommended during major celebrations.
